摘要
In the context of global carbon peak and carbon neutrality, the issue of how to effectively encourage enterprises to reduce their carbon emissions has drawn the attention of governments and scholars. This paper uses the difference-in-differences method and joint data (2003-2012) from Chinese industrial firm pollution database and Chinese industrial firm database to evaluate the impacts of environmental information disclosure on enterprises' carbon emissions. We find that environmental information disclosure has a significant effect on enterprises' carbon emission reduction. Moderating effect analysis finds that environmental regulations and punishment strengthen the role of environmental information disclosure in reducing carbon emissions, however, the moderating role of environmental punishment is limited. In addition, mechanism analysis show that environmental information disclosure can reduce carbon emissions by improving their energy structures and encouraging polluting enterprises to withdraw from the market.
